Even More Ambers

Me  and my Brother in law went out, with Daz and Chrisp following later.

 

Very windy in the morning, we left at 8.30 but had to hang inshore for about 45 minutes until the patience wore thin and we headed out. Strong north easterly, but it died right down half way to Rotto and by the time we reached Rotto it was light winds, and stayed that way all day....we came home in an almost glassoff. EXCELLENT!

 

Fishing was a bit tough. Fish on the sounder, but had to work very hard for the fish, but we had it much easier than others it would seem. Spoke with Justonemore cast and Justin out there, both had a hard time and not sure if they boated a fish despite a LOT of jigging.

 

It was my bro in law’s first time jigging……he gave up on jigging after 15 minutes on his Torium 30 completely stuffed (I did warn him it would be tough work on that gear...) so I put him on live baits which were also slow but did get two nice Ambers, so he was happy.

 

I got 3 ambers to the boat on jig, lost another 2 to sharks (got one jig back.....munched....), lost another and 120 m of brand new YGK braid to an incorrect drag setting on my spanking new Ocea Jigger (which was pure SWEETNESS!!!!!) and my favourite  jig....got hit about another 4 times for no hookup…..so it was tough, but worth while.

 

Daz  Chrisp and one of their mates did better than us on Team Prowler….good fishos those boyz!

 

At the end of the day, just after Daz and Chrisp left and we were the only boat left, I had probably the best fishing experience I have ever had.....had just packed all the gear away, Daz was just heading out of sight over the horizon and we were feeling like a very small boat on a very big, dead flat ocean, we started the motors and started to drive off and all hell broke loose....Ambers busting up on the surface everywhere, smashing baitfish all around the boat. There were hundreds of Ambers within meters of the baot. With all rods packed away except my Tierra flick rod with a McCarthys paddle tail (rigged for tuna) I flung it out, and got SMASHED on the surface with a big massive splash...awesome! Great fight on the light gear.

 

Will remember those 15 minutes for a long time!

Good day out! Conditions were mint. It gave me the opportunity to have 3 in the prowler. The prowler performed well & we enjoyed getting several fish each.

The ambers actually responded well to slowly worked jigs. Lighter gear got more touches but the sharks were sitting under the school which made things hard if one stripped too much line.
